### Runbook: SQL lint gate (Pondwright release)

Before promoting, run the lint stage: flags unqualified table names, missing transaction wrappers, and nonstandard casing in migration SQL. Lint failures block the release; do not override without a second on-call ack. Signed promotion requires the current deploy key, which follows.

signing key of bagap-yawep = bky13_TbfT6ZMUoGJo2

**Handover Note — Director Transition**

To branch managers: as I hand operations to Director Salvane, a note on next year's training budget. The allocation rises modestly, with priority given to the Fieldcraft certification program and onboarding at the new Alderbeck branch. Travel-based training is capped; use the Lumenhall virtual modules where possible. Submit branch requests by end of November. Salvane will confirm final figures in December. There is one additional point to share.

management briefing: Project Ulavan slips by two quarters because of the staffing delay.

Subject: Loyalty Programme Overhaul — Financial Implications

Finance team,

We are restructuring the Copperleaf Rewards programme ahead of next fiscal year. Points accrual drops to 1.5% of spend, offset by richer redemption tiers for top accounts. Modelling suggests a net liability reduction of roughly 11%. Please validate the accrual assumptions before we brief the executive committee. The commercial reasoning is summarised below.

internal memo for kawip-hadug: Headcount on the Wenwyn team goes from 7 to 140 by the end of January. Gross margin on Wenwyn came in at 20 percent against a plan of 15 percent.